The Importance Of A Restaurant Table Reservation System

In the fast-paced and competitive restaurant industry, having an efficient and effective table reservation system can make the difference between a fully booked dining room and half-empty tables. A restaurant table reservation system is a crucial tool that allows restaurants to manage their bookings, maximize their seating capacity, and provide a better experience for their customers. In this article, we will explore the importance of a restaurant table reservation system and how it can benefit both restaurant owners and diners.

One of the main benefits of a restaurant table reservation system is that it helps to streamline the booking process for both the restaurant and the customers. Instead of calling the restaurant and waiting on hold to make a reservation, customers can simply go online and book a table in just a few clicks. This not only saves time for the customers but also reduces the workload for restaurant staff, allowing them to focus on providing excellent service to diners in the restaurant.

Furthermore, a restaurant table reservation system can help to reduce the number of no-shows and last-minute cancellations. By requiring customers to provide their credit card information when making a reservation, restaurants can charge a fee for no-shows or late cancellations, which encourages customers to honor their bookings or cancel in a timely manner. This helps to prevent lost revenue from empty tables and ensures that the restaurant can maximize its seating capacity and generate more income.

Another significant advantage of a restaurant table reservation system is that it allows restaurants to manage their waitlist more effectively. When all tables are booked, customers can add themselves to the waitlist through the online reservation system and receive notifications when a table becomes available. This helps to reduce the chaos and confusion that can occur when managing a waitlist manually and ensures that customers have a more seamless and enjoyable dining experience.

Additionally, a restaurant table reservation system can provide valuable data and insights for restaurant owners. By tracking reservation trends, peak dining times, and customer preferences, restaurant owners can make more informed decisions about staffing levels, menu offerings, and marketing strategies. This data can help restaurants to optimize their operations, improve their overall profitability, and attract more customers to their establishment.

For diners, a restaurant table reservation system offers convenience and flexibility when planning a dining experience. Instead of showing up to a restaurant and hoping for a table, customers can secure their preferred dining time in advance and avoid long wait times. This not only enhances the overall dining experience for customers but also encourages repeat visits and customer loyalty.
